Set in Euroka Clearing within Glenbrook National Park, the Glenbrook Marathon offers a true trail-running experience in the Blue Mountains, New South Wales. The event features three course options: 25 km, 34 km, and the full marathon, all on single-track and fire trails with challenging climbs and sweeping views. Runners pass major park highlights, including lookouts and Aboriginal artwork, plus rarely seen spots. The course hub is at Euroka Clearing, creating a rugged, natural atmosphere ideal for trail enthusiasts. The event takes place October 19, 2025, and attracts a welcoming, outdoors-focused community eager to explore this iconic Blue Mountains region.
